Transaction 318524c9f144089aeda1187486d92e08b1e5c5c13e3369d1f81e23ab879ebff0

block
a155812e4947b2f3250ec26b8c2ff563b7fcb97b9743f4549eaeb827951fc98e

206 Inputs

2 Outputs